  • Says It Leaves State’s Response Coordination In Limbo

Akanimo Kufre (The New Diplomat’s A/Ibom|C/River Correspondent) contributed to this story.

Akwa Ibom state Governor, Udom Emmanuel has been asked to reinstate the purportedly sacked state Epidemiologist, Dr. Aniekeme Uwah who is also heading the state’s Incidence Management Committee on Covid-19.

According to a statement made available to The New Diplomat by the Akwa Ibom State Civil Society Organizations Forum, the purported sack of the Epidemiologist stemmed from his insistence on getting more people in the state tested for the Covid-19 infection.

Akwa Ibom has recorded 11 confirmed cases of the Coronavirus infection, according to figures released on Friday by Nigeria Centre for Disease Control.

In the statement signed by its Chairman, Harry Udoh Udoh, the group decried the sack by the Commissioner for Health in the state, Dominic Ukpong, saying such action is counter productive to the state’s Covid-19 response coordination.

“The Akwa Ibom State Civil Society Organizations Forum decries the reported sacked of Dr. Aniekeme Uwah, the State Epidemiologist and Lead of the State’s Incidence Management Committee for COVID19 by the state’s Commissioner for Health, Dr. Dominic Ukpong.

“The forum is shocked that the state could muster the courage to sack the foremost epidemiologist at this critical time, especially with palpable fears among the citizenry that the virus might have spread more the government would want the world to believe.

“Dr. Uwah is reported to have been sacked because he sent more blood samples for testing that the than his immediate boss the Health Commission would have wanted him to. If this report is true, then the decision to sack the lead epidemiologist would a most terrible decision and a disservice to the state.

“Dr Aniekeme Uwah who is a reputed medical professional with wealth of experience in Public Health and expertise in curbing Infectious diseases and highly sought after in Africa, and was recently honored by the African Union for his meritorious service fighting Ebola outbreak in Liberia between 2014 and 2015, and who is currently the Secretary, Common Wealth Medical Association’s Covid 19 Response Committee is an asset to the state.”

The group asked Governor Emmanuel to quickly wade in and ensure the reinstatement of the state’s Epidemiologist to continue to lead the fight against the ravaging virus in the state.

“Akwa Ibom State Civil Society Organizations Forum, hereby calls on the state governor to wade into the matter and reinstate Dr. Aniekeme Uwah. His sack at this time would worsen the already precarious situation caused by this rampaging pandemic.

“Furthermore, if the reason reported for the sack is indeed true, then it raises a lot of questions. Why is the state government intent on reducing the number of people tested? Didn’t the state government put out a release a few days back declaring they were embarking on aggressive testing?

“What is the number of people tested so far? Why is the state government shrouding the management of the COVID19 pandemic in the state in secrecy?
What are they hiding?

“While we leave the state government to provide answers to these questions, we passionately plead with the state governor, His Excellency, Deacon Udom Gabriel Emmanuel to reinstate Dr, Aniekeme Uwah for the good of Akwa ibom state Citizens,” the said.

The New Diplomat recalls health professional groups including the Nigerian Medical Association had recently called for the sack of the Commissioner for Health in Akwa Ibom.

The groups criticized Ukpong leadership style alleging high-handedness, lack of regards to the health professionals and poor inter-personal relationship with professional bodies in the health sector in the state.
